  • Following consultations with the US, Qatari negotiators traveled to Tehran this morning to meet with the Iranians in an effort to bridge the remaining gaps, the source said.
  • The visit signals that diplomacy remains active despite Iran and the US exchanging fire overnight in one of the biggest tests yet for the ceasefire.
